OREGON STATE UNIVERSITY

International Study Abroad and Student Exchange Programs

1997-98

Opportunities for students to study abroad continue to expand at OSU. There are now 38 programs in 19 countries. A new policy on international exchange, implemented in 1992 by a faculty Study Abroad Advisory Committee (SAAC), encourages departments to initiate and administer international exchange and study abroad programs specific to their academic units. The purpose of the new policy is to encourage faculty initiatives and to expand the diversity of academic programs and geographic locations available through study abroad and student/faculty exchange programs. Study Abroad and Student Exchange Programs at OSU are defined as Category A or Category B programs.

Category A: The Office of International Education continues to administer programs with a broad scope involving students from a number of academic units. These include the Oregon State University System (OUS) programs in China, Ecuador, France, Germany, Hungary, Japan, Korea, Mexico, and Thailand. Also included are the Northwest Council on Study Abroad (NCSA) programs in Angers, France; Vienna, Austria; London, England; Macerata and Siena, Italy. Programs in Bathurst, Australia; Sussex, England; and the Former Soviet Union are open to all students and are administered in the Office of International Education.

Category B: Programs involving students from one department or college will be the responsibility of that academic unit with the Office of International Education providing assistance, support, and budget review. This new policy has already generated several new programs and administrative changes. The College of Engineering has year-long programs for engineering students at the University of Nottingham, the University of Sussex, and the University of Mexico. College of Science students may spend a year at the University of Lancaster, the University of Sussex or the University of Wales. Agriculture students have programs at the University of British Columbia and at Lincoln College in New Zealand. A College of Liberal Arts program in Guadalajara, Mexico places education students in bilingual schools for field experience, and Spanish language majors work in language schools. The College of Business has programs at Agder College in Kristiansand, Norway and Aarhus and Copenhagen, Denmark.

Global Graduates Internships

Global Graduates: The Oregon International Internship Program enables OSU students from all fields of study to integrate an international internship experience into their degree program. Students gain valuable practical work experience while at the same time perfecting language proficiency and their ability to work in a different cultural context. Internships can vary in length, from three to six months, and in format, to include a domestic internship or a study abroad program. Internship placements are in a wide range of countries. Language requirements vary depending on the specific position responsibilities of the internship.
